Pooled standardized mean differences (SMDs) with 95% confidence intervals (CIs) were calculated.
RT+HMB produced modest and borderline significant improvements in handgrip strength (SMD 0.24; 95% CI 0.00-0.48; p = 0.05) and moderate benefits in Short Physical Performance Battery (SPPB) scores (SMD 0.54; 95% CI 0.12-0.95; p = 0.01).
Five trials (50%) were rated at high risk of bias, limiting confidence in pooled estimates.

The results displayed a significant improvement on endurance performance (pooled standardized mean difference [SMD] = 0.58 [0.28-0.87]) and V̇O 2 max (pooled SMD = 0.58 [0.21-0.95]) after HMB ingestion.
Moreover, after the exclusion of the studies not evenly distributed around the base of the funnel plot, the results continued to be significantly positive in endurance performance (pooled SMD = 0.38 [0.22-0.53]) and V̇O 2 max (pooled SMD = 0.25 [0.09-0.42]).
In conclusion, HMB (3 g·d -1 ) ingestion during 2-12 weeks significantly improves endurance performance and V̇O 2 max .

For the overall risk of bias, no studies were graded as "high risk of bias", one (20.0 %) as "some concerns", and four (80.0 %) as "low risk of bias" according to the ROB 2.
However, there was no evidence of a benefit on physical performance, assessed by gait speed (SMD = 0.19; 95 % CI: [-0.14, 0.53]; Z value = 1.14; P = 0.255).
Overall, although limited and requiring interpretation with utmost caution, current evidence indicates that HMB supplementation is beneficial for improving muscle mass and strength, but there is no evidence of a benefit on physical performance in patients with sarcopenia.

It is also uncertain whether arginine, glutamine and β-hydroxy-β-methylbutyrate supplement increases the proportion of ulcers healed at 16 weeks compared with placebo (RR 1.09, 95% CI 0.85 to 1.40).
It is uncertain whether oral nutritional supplement with 20 g protein per 200 mL bottle, 1 kcal/mL, nutritional supplement with added vitamins, minerals and trace elements, reduces the number of deaths (RR 0.96, 95% CI 0.06 to 14.60) or amputations (RR 4.82, 95% CI 0.24 to 95.88) more than placebo.
It is uncertain whether arginine, glutamine and β-hydroxy-β-methylbutyrate supplement increases health-related quality of life at 16 weeks more than placebo (MD -0.03, 95% CI -0.09 to 0.03).

A significant effect was found on TBM.
However, there were no significant effects for FFM, FM, or strength outcomes.
We conclude that HMB produces a small effect on TBM gain, but this effect does not translate into significantly greater increases in FFM, strength or decreases in FM during periods of RET.

Results showed that HMB supplementation in addition to physical exercise has no or fairly low impact in improving body composition, muscle strength, or physical performance in adults aged 50 to 80 years, compared to exercise alone.
There is a gap of knowledge on the beneficial effects of HMB combined with exercise to preserve cognitive functions in aging and age-related neurodegenerative diseases.
Future RCTs are needed to refine treatment choices combining HMB and exercises for older people in particular populations, ages, and health status.

HMB supplementation interventions present a trivial non-significant ES in all variables studied (bench press ES=0.00, leg press ES=0.09, body mass ES=-0.01, fat-free mass ES=0.16, and fat mass ES=-0.20; all cases p>0.05, and null heterogeneity I2=0.0% p>0.05).
These results remained constant even analyzing by subgroups (HMB doses, duration of intervention, training level and diet co-intervention).
This meta-analysis found no effect of HMB supplementation on strength and body composition in trained and competitive athletes.
